Практическое руководство. Создание решений для нескольких проектов

Любое решение может содержать один или несколько проектов. Решения с несколькими проектами создаются путем добавления проектов в существующее решение. Дополнительные сведения о создании решений см. в разделе Практическое руководство. Создание решений и проектов.

Решения создаются несколькими путями:

  • новый файл добавляется в пустое решение;

  • проект добавляется в пустой Обозреватель решений;

  • пустое решение добавляется из узла Другие типы проектов, Решения Visual Studio диалогового окна Создать проект.

Таким образом, структура физической связи файлов решения устанавливается во время создания файла или проекта.

В решении с несколькими проектами систематизированная файловая структура, точно отражающая связи между проектами и соответствующими файлами, удобна на протяжении всего цикла разработки, особенно для больших проектов. Для всех проектов можно установить корневой каталог решений, в котором будут сохраняться все локальные файлы, а все проекты будут по умолчанию создаваться в папках, именуемых по имени проекта. Дополнительные сведения см. в разделах Практическое руководство. Создание каталогов для решений и Управление элементами в проектах.

Примечание

Много проектов, связанных между собой системой управления версиями, легче использовать совместно, если создавать их в общем каталоге решений.

Добавление проектов в решение

В решение можно добавить либо новый проект, либо существующий.

Добавление нового проекта в решение

  1. В Обозревателе решений выберите решение или папку решения, в которую требуется добавить проект.

  2. В меню Файл последовательно выберите пункты Добавить и Новый проект.

  3. Выберите Тип проекта и Шаблон.

В решение можно добавить существующий проект, а затем изменить этот проект в соответствии с требованиями этого решения.

Добавление существующего проекта в решение

  1. В Обозревателе решений выберите решение или папку решения, в которую требуется добавить проект.

  2. В меню Файл выберите пункт Добавить, а затем команду Существующий проект.

  3. Выберите проект, который требуется добавить в решение.

Примечание

Доступ к командам Добавить новый проект и Добавить существующий проект можно получить, щелкнув правой кнопкой мыши решение в окне Обозреватель решений.

Удаление решений

Можно окончательно удалить все решение, но не с помощью среды разработки Visual Studio.

Чтобы удалить решение окончательно

  1. Прежде чем удалить решение, переместите все проекты, которые, возможно, потребуется использовать снова.

  2. С помощью проводника Windows удалите каталог, содержащий два файла решений, SLN и SUO.

См. также

Задачи

Практическое руководство. Создание каталогов для решений

Практическое руководство. Создание решений и проектов

Другие ресурсы

New Project Dialog Box

Add New Project Dialog Box